Buying expensive presents is boring, IMO. If she really wants a camera, it might be an OK gift but in my experience women tend to like thoughtful gifts better than expensive ones. Last Christmas I got my girl a copy of Mike Doughty's (ex-frontman of Soul Coughing, her favorite band) latest CD and tried to get him to sign it. I couldn't get it signed before Christmas so the next time he was in Minneapolis for a show I got tickets and got him to sign it there.

Indie CD: $12
Tickets to show: $32
Girlfriend bawling her eyes out: Priceless

I want a digital camera butIamme is right, some of the 2MP ones are cheap and give very nice quality for the average person.

well people don't get 2mpix because its optimal but because they settle on it as what they are willing to spend or can afford, or simply don'tknow any better. 2megapixels isn't good enough for good large prints, and even small prints don't have quite the clarity. you don't have a pixel budget to crop at all... its far less then optimal if your taking pictures you want to keep. it certainly doesn't get even near 35mm.

i would take another route.

spend more on dinner, $40 gets you.... not much... i mean, 15% tip on $40 would be $6, tax is another $3, so thats close to $10, leaving only $30 for two dinners + appetizers and drinks?

go with roses instead of balloons, she can dry them and save them. a dozen roses at safeway is $10, just deliver them yourself. surprise her. and girls ALWAYS tell other girls about how many roses their bf got them.

anniversary card - $3, this is a MUST. spend some time, and write something heartfelt in it. she'd probly enjoy this more than any gift.

your anniversary is suppose to be a celebration of the time you have spent together, so dont worry about the gift too much. its not her birthday.

if you're set on getting a camera, do what everyone else has suggested, get a nice 2MP one. odds are, she wont know the difference.
